코딩고치

[파이썬][백준] 11650번: 좌표 정렬하기 본문

파이썬/백준 문제

[파이썬][백준] 11650번: 좌표 정렬하기

코딩고치 2020. 5. 27. 23:12

1. 문제

주소: https://www.acmicpc.net/problem/11650

 

11650번: 좌표 정렬하기

첫째 줄에 점의 개수 N (1 ≤ N ≤ 100,000)이 주어진다. 둘째 줄부터 N개의 줄에는 i번점의 위치 xi와 yi가 주어진다. (-100,000 ≤ xi, yi ≤ 100,000) 좌표는 항상 정수이고, 위치가 같은 두 점은 없다.

www.acmicpc.net

문제 유형: 정렬

 

2. 소스코드

n = int(input())

coordinate_list = []
for _ in range(n):
    x, y = map(int, input().split(' '))
    coordinate_list.append([x, y])

sorted_coordinate_list = sorted(coordinate_list, key = lambda x: (x[0], x[1]))

for coordinate in sorted_coordinate_list:
    print(coordinate[0], coordinate[1])
Comments